Identifying Priority Areas for Snow and Ice Management at Sports Complexes

Developing a successful snow and ice management plan starts with identifying the critical areas within your sports complex that require attention during winter weather events. These priority areas generally include the following:

  1. Entrances and Exits: Keep entry and exit points clear for athletes, staff, and visitors to prevent potential slip-and-fall hazards.
  2. Parking Lots and Driveways: Maintain safe and accessible vehicle and pedestrian traffic routes throughout the facility.
  3. Sidewalks and Walkways: Ensure that pathways connecting various parts of the complex are cleared of snow and ice to minimize risks for users.
  4. Playing Surfaces: Protect turf, ice rinks, and other surfaces by promptly removing snow and ice to maintain their functional integrity.

By identifying and addressing these priority areas, sports complex managers can minimize hazards and keep their facilities safe throughout the winter season.

Adopting Preventive Measures for Sports Complex Snow and Ice Management

Proactive planning and preventive measures play a vital role in managing snow and ice within sports complexes effectively. Some essential preventive strategies include the following:

  1. Weather Monitoring: Regularly track weather forecasts to anticipate incoming winter storms and adjust your snow and ice management plan accordingly.
  2. Pre-treatment Applications: Use environmentally-friendly ice-melting products to pre-treat key areas of your complex, reducing ice formation during winter storms.
  3. Staff Training and Communication: Ensure maintenance staff is properly trained in snow and ice management best practices and establish effective communication channels for prompt response to winter weather events.

Implementing these preventive measures can help sports complex managers proactively address winter weather challenges and maintain a safe environment for all users.

Innovative Snow and Ice Removal Solutions for Sports Complexes

Utilizing advanced snow and ice removal solutions can greatly improve the safety and efficiency of your sports complex during the winter season. Key technologies and methodologies to consider include the following:

  1. Automated Snow Removal Equipment: Streamline the snow removal process using advanced, automated equipment that allows for more efficient and precise clearing of snow from playing surfaces, parking lots, and walkways.
  2. Environmentally-Friendly Deicing Products: Opt for eco-conscious ice melting products that are both effective in ice removal and environmentally friendly, minimizing damage to playing surfaces and surrounding landscaping.
  3. GPS-Enabled Fleet Management: Leverage GPS technology to monitor and manage snow removal equipment, ensuring efficient routing and resource allocation during snow and ice events.

Integrating these technological advancements into your snow and ice management plan can significantly enhance safety and operational efficiency at your sports complex during the winter months.
